BACKGROUND: Venous thromboembolism (VTE) is most prevalent among parturients following a cesarean section (CS). The objective of this study was to assess the practical utility of bilateral compression ultrasonography (CUS) of the lower limbs, coupled with D-dimer monitoring, in the early diagnosis of VTE within the Han Chinese population. METHODS: Our prospective observational study included 742 women who underwent CUS and D-dimer testing on the first day post-CS. Subsequently, telephone or outpatient follow-ups were conducted until 42 days postpartum. States of hypercoagulation and thrombosis, as indicated by CUS, were classified as CUS abnormal. A D-dimer level ≥ 3 mg/l was considered the D-dimer warning value. Early ambulation and mechanical prophylaxis were universally recommended for all parturients post-CS. A sequential diagnostic strategy, based on the 2015 RCOG VTE risk-assessment tool, was employed. Therapeutic doses of low-molecular-weight heparin (LMWH) were administered for the treatment of thromboembolic disease. Prophylactic doses of LMWH were given for VTE prophylaxis in parturients with hypercoagulative status accompanied by D-dimer levels ≥ 3 mg/l. All high-risk women (RCOG score ≥ 4 points) were additionally treated with preventive LMWH. Statistical analyses were conducted using the R statistical software, with a two-sided P value < 0.05 considered statistically significant. RESULTS: Fifteen cases of VTE and 727 instances without VTE were observed. The overall VTE rate post-CS was 2.02% (15/742), with 66.7% (10/15) being asymptomatic. Eleven patients received a VTE diagnosis on the first postpartum day. Among the 41 parturients exhibiting hypercoagulation ultrasound findings and D-dimer levels ≥ 3 mg/l, despite receiving pharmacological VTE prophylaxis with LMWH, 4.88% (2/41) in the high-risk group were eventually diagnosed with VTE. A total of 30.86% (229/742) exhibited normal ultrasound findings and D-dimer levels < 3 mg/l on the first day post-CS, with no VTE occurrences in the postpartum follow-up. According to RCOG's recommendation, 78.03% (579/742) of cesarean delivery women should receive prophylactic anticoagulation, while only 20.62% (153/742) met our criterion for prophylactic anticoagulation. CONCLUSION: The strategy of timely routine bilateral CUS and D-dimer monitoring is conducive to the early diagnosis and treatment of VTE, significantly reducing the use of LMWH in the Chinese Han population.

Drought stress can seriously affect the yield and quality of wheat (Triticum aestivum). So far, although few wheat heat shock transcription factors (Hsfs) have been found to be involved in the stress response, the biological functions of them, especially the members of the HsfC (heat shock transcription factor C) subclass, remain largely unknown. Here, we identified a class C encoding gene, TaHsfC3-4, based on our previous omics data and analyzed its biological function in transgenic plants. TaHsfC3-4 encodes a protein containing 274 amino acids and shows the basic characteristics of the HsfC class. Gene expression profiles revealed that TaHsfC3-4 was constitutively expressed in many tissues of wheat and was induced during seed maturation. TaHsfC3-4 could be upregulated by PEG and abscisic acid (ABA), suggesting that this Hsf may be involved in the regulation pathway depending on ABA in drought resistance. Further results represented that TaHsfC3-4 was localized in the nucleus but had no transcriptional activation activity. Notably, overexpression of TaHsfC3-4 in Arabidopsis thaliana pyr1pyl1pyl2pyl4 (pyr1pyl124) quadruple mutant plants complemented the ABA-hyposensitive phenotypes of the quadruple mutant including cotyledon greening, root elongation, seedling growth, and increased tolerance to drought, indicating positive roles of TaHsfC3-4 in the ABA signaling pathway and drought tolerance. Furthermore, we identified TaHsfA2-11 as a TaHsfC3-4-interacting protein by yeast two-hybrid (Y2H) screening. The experimental data show that TaHsfC3-4 can indeed interact with TaHsfA2-11 in vitro and in vivo. Moreover, transgenic Arabidopsis TaHsfA2-11 overexpression lines exhibited enhanced drought tolerance, too. In summary, our study confirmed the role of TaHsfC3-4 in response to drought stress and provided a target locus for marker-assisted selection breeding to improve drought tolerance in wheat.

OBJECTIVES: This retrospective cohort study aimed to assess the efficacy of emergency cervical cerclage (ECC) performed with the combined McDonald-Shirodkar technique in twin pregnancies between 18 and 26 weeks of pregnancy with painless cervical dilation 1 to 6 cm. METHODS: A retrospective cohort study matched with the degree of cervical dilation was conducted. The study group (case group) included women with twin pregnancies undergoing combined McDonald-Shirodkar approach with cervical dilation ≥1 cm between 18 to 26 weeks of gestation at four institutions, from December 2015 to December 2022. To minimize confounding factors, we elucidated the causality structure using a directed acyclic graph and performed 1:1 case-control matching. A control group underwent the McDonald approach. The primary outcome was gestational age (GA) at delivery. The secondary outcomes were pregnancy latency; the rates of spontaneous preterm birth at <28, <30, <32, and <34 weeks; and neonatal outcomes. Additional subanalysis was performed by dividing the patients into two subgroups of women with cervical dilation ≥3 cm and <3 cm. RESULTS: A total of 84 twin pregnancies were managed with either the combined McDonald-Shirodkar approach (case group: n = 42) or the McDonald approach (control group: n = 42). Demographic characteristics were not significantly different in the two groups (P > 0.05). After adjusting for confounders that were represented by a directed acyclic graph, median GA at delivery was significantly higher (30.5 vs 27 weeks; Bate: 3.40 [95% confidence interval (CI), 2.13-4.67], P < 0.001) and median pregnancy latency was significantly longer (56 vs 28 days; Bate: 24.04 [95% CI, 13.31-34.78], P < 0.001) in the case group compared with the control group. Rates of spontaneous preterm birth at <28, <30, <32, and <34 weeks were significantly lower in the case group than in the control group. For neonatal outcomes, there was higher birth weight (1543.75 vs 980 g; Bate: 420.08 [95% CI, 192.18-647.98], P < 0.001) and significantly lower overall perinatal mortality (7.1% vs 31%; adjusted odds ratio, 0.16 [95% CI, 0.04-0.70], P = 0.014) in the case group compared with the control group. When cervical dilation was ≥3 cm, the combined McDonald-Shirodkar procedure can significantly reduce perinatal mortality (8.3% vs 46.7%; adjusted odds ratio, 0.09 [95% CI, 0.01-0.77], P = 0.028), significantly decrease the risk of delivery at <28 and <30 weeks, and prolong GA at delivery and pregnancy latency compared with the McDonald procedure. CONCLUSIONS: ECC performed with the combined McDonald-Shirodkar procedure in women with twin pregnancies who have cervical dilation 1 to 6 cm in midtrimester pregnancy may reduce the rate of spontaneous preterm birth and improve perinatal and neonatal outcomes compared with the McDonald procedure, especially for twin pregnancies in women with cervical dilation of 3 to 6 cm and prolapsed membranes.

INTRODUCTION: Emergency cervical cerclage is a recognized method for preventing mid-trimester pregnancy loss and premature birth; however, its benefits remain controversial. This study aimed to establish preoperative models predicting preterm birth and gestational latency following emergency cervical cerclage in singleton pregnant patients with a high risk of preterm birth. MATERIAL AND METHODS: We retrospectively reviewed data from patients who received emergency cerclage between 2015 and 2023 in three institutions. Patients were grouped into a derivation cohort (n = 141) and an independent validation cohort (n = 61). Univariate and multivariate logistic and Cox regression analyses were used to identify independent predictive variables and establish the models. Harrell's C-index, time-dependent receiver operating characteristic curves and areas under the curves, calibration curve, and decision curve analyses were performed to assess the models. RESULTS: The models incorporated gestational weeks at cerclage placement, history of prior second-trimester loss and/or preterm birth, cervical dilation, and preoperative C-reactive protein level. The C-index of the model for predicting preterm birth before 28 weeks was 0.87 (95% CI: 0.82-0.93) in the derivation cohort and 0.82 (95% CI: 0.71-0.92) in the independent validation cohort; The C-index of the model for predicting gestational latency was 0.70 (95% CI: 0.66-0.75) and 0.78 (95% CI: 0.71-0.84), respectively. In the derivation set, the areas under the curves were 0.84, 0.81, and 0.84 for predicting 1-, 3- and 5-week pregnancy prolongation, respectively. The corresponding values for the external validation were 0.78, 0.78, and 0.79, respectively. Calibration curves showed a good homogeneity between the observed and predicted ongoing pregnant probabilities. Decision curve analyses revealed satisfactory clinical usefulness. CONCLUSIONS: These novel models provide reliable and valuable prognostic predictions for patients undergoing emergency cerclage. The models can assist clinicians and patients in making personalized clinical decisions before opting for the cervical cerclage.

PURPOSE: To develop a nomogram to predict spontaneous preterm birth at < 28 weeks in pregnant women with twin pregnancies. METHODS: We retrospectively studied the medical records of twin-pregnancy women with asymptomatic cervical dilation or cervical shortening between December 2015 to February 2022 in two hospitals. Data from one center was used to develop the model and data from the other was used to evaluate the model. RESULTS: A total of 270 twin pregnancies were enrolled in the study. We incorporated 4 items (cervical length, cervical dilation, C-reactive protein and the use of cerclage) to build the 28-week nomogram with satisfactory discrimination and calibration when applied to the validation sets. The C index for the 28-week nomogram in the development and external cohort was 0.88 (95% CI, 0.84-0.93) and 0.89 (95% CI, 0.80-0.98), respectively. The nomogram reached a sensitivity of 70.70%, specificity of 97.10%, positive predicted value of 95.61% and negative predicted value of 78.77%. Moreover, the decision curve analysis indicated that the nomogram showed positive clinical benefit. CONCLUSION: We developed and validated a nomogram with good performance in predicting individual risk of spontaneous preterm birth at < 28 in twin pregnancy.

OBJECTIVE: To evaluate the value of transvaginal ultrasound parameters before and after cerclage in twins in predicting spontaneous preterm birth (sPTB) before 28+0 weeks. METHODS: We retrospectively studied the medical records of twin-pregnant women who underwent ultrasound-indicated cerclage between January 2016 and February 2022 at our hospital. Recorded transvaginal ultrasound images before and after cerclage were reassessed for cervical length (CL), uterocervical angle (UCA), funneling, and sludge. Multivariate logistic and Cox regression analyses were performed to identify the independent risk factors associated with sPTB before 28 weeks. RESULTS: A total of 69 women were included. Among them, 17 women (24.64%) delivered before 28 weeks of age. Regression analysis revealed a significant association of post-cerclage CL, UCA, white blood cell (WBC) count, and gestational age (GA) at cerclage with sPTB before 28 weeks. The area under the curve of these predictors was 0.938 (95% confidence interval, 0.882-0.994; p < .001), with a sensitivity of 88.2%, specificity of 92.3%, positive predictive value of 78.9%, and negative predictive value of 96.0%. Cox analysis showed that post-cerclage UCA was an independent risk factor affecting the cerclage-to-delivery interval (hazard ratios, 1.026; 95% confidence interval (CI), 1.004-1.048; p = .019). CONCLUSIONS: The combination of post-cerclage CL, UCA, WBC count, and GA at cerclage showed good performance in predicting sPTB at <28 weeks in twin pregnancy. Post-cerclage UCA is also associated with pregnancy latency. We found that post-cerclage cervical ultrasound may be useful to predict preterm birth before 28 weeks in twins who undergo ultrasound-indicated cerclage.

High temperature has severely affected plant growth and development, resulting in reduced production of crops worldwide, especially wheat. Alternative splicing (AS), a crucial post-transcriptional regulatory mechanism, is involved in the growth and development of eukaryotes and the adaptation to environmental changes. Previous transcriptome data suggested that heat shock transcription factor (Hsf) TaHsfA2-7 may form different transcripts by AS. However, it remains unclear whether this post-transcriptional regulatory mechanism of TaHsfA2-7 is related to thermotolerance in wheat (Triticum aestivum). Here, we identified a novel splice variant, TaHsfA2-7-AS, which was induced by high temperature and played a positive role in thermotolerance regulation in wheat. Moreover, TaHsfA2-7-AS is predicted to encode a small truncated TaHsfA2-7 isoform, retaining only part of the DNA-binding domain (DBD). TaHsfA2-7-AS is constitutively expressed in various tissues of wheat. Notably, the expression level of TaHsfA2-7-AS is significantly up-regulated by heat shock (HS) during flowering and grain-filling stages in wheat. Further studies showed that TaHsfA2-7-AS was localized in the nucleus but lacked transcriptional activation activity. Ectopic expression of TaHsfA2-7-AS in yeast exhibited improved thermotolerance. Compared to non-transgenic plants, overexpression of TaHsfA2-7-AS in Arabidopsis results in enhanced tolerance to heat stress. Simultaneously, we also found that TaHsfA1 is directly involved in the transcriptional regulation of TaHsfA2-7 and TaHsfA2-7-AS. In summary, our findings demonstrate the function of TaHsfA2-7-AS splicing variant in response to heat stress and establish a link between regulatory mechanisms of AS and the improvement of thermotolerance in wheat.

BACKGROUND: Pelvic dimensions are crucial variables in the labour process. We used magnetic resonance imaging (MRI) pelvimetry to predict the probability of vaginal delivery and distinguish the cephalopelvic disproportion risk in women with prolonged active labour. METHODS: This prospective cohort study enrolled term nulliparous women willing to undergo MRI pelvimetry and a trial of labour. A nomogram, with vaginal birth as the outcome, was developed and evaluated by calibration curve and decision curve analyses. The pairwise association between maternal and fetal parameters and a prolonged first stage of labour was quantified. RESULTS: Head circumference (HC), abdominal circumference (AC), intertuberous distance (ITD), interspinous diameter (ISD), and body mass index (BMI) were introduced to develop a nomogram with good diagnostic performance (area under the curve = 0.799, sensitivity = 83%, and specificity = 73%). The cephalopelvic index of diameter (CID) in 54 women with a prolonged first stage of labour was much smaller in those who delivered via cesarean section compared with those who delivered vaginally (18.09 ± 1.14 vs. 21.29 ± 1.06; p = 0.046). CONCLUSIONS: An MRI pelvimetry-based nomogram may predict the probability of vaginal delivery. Practitioners should reassess the pelvimetry parameters to decide whether the trial of labour should be continued if it is prolonged.

BACKGROUND: Twin pregnancies with a progressively shortening cervix in the midterm pregnancy have an increasing risk for spontaneous preterm birth. Currently, there is no known effective method to prevent preterm birth among those women, and the use of an ultrasound-indicated cerclage in twin pregnancies is still controversial. OBJECTIVE: This study aimed to estimate whether a combination of ultrasound-indicated cerclage, indomethacin, and antibiotics in twin pregnancies between 18 and 26 weeks' gestation could extend the pregnancy, reduce the risk for spontaneous preterm birth, and improve perinatal and neonatal outcomes. STUDY DESIGN: A retrospective cohort study was conducted. The ultrasound-indicated cerclage group included twin pregnancies with a transvaginal cervical length <25 mm that underwent cerclage at 18 to 26 weeks of gestation in the Women's Hospital, Zhejiang University School of Medicine, from December 2015 through August 2021. Twin pregnancies in our study that underwent cerclage also received antibiotics and indomethacin. A control group of twin pregnancies that were managed expectantly were matched with the treatment group in terms of transvaginal cervical length at diagnosis (±3 mm), gestational age at presentation of diagnosis (±3 weeks), and maternal age (±5 years). An additional subanalysis was performed in which the patients were divided into 2 subgroups based on transvaginal cervical length of either <15 mm or between 15 and 24 mm. The primary outcome was gestational age at delivery. The secondary outcomes were pregnancy latency, the rate of spontaneous preterm birth at <28, <32, <34, <36 weeks' gestation, and neonatal outcomes. RESULTS: A total of 90 twin pregnancies with a transvaginal cervical length <25 mm were managed with either a cerclage (ultrasound-indicated cerclage group, n=45) or expectantly (control group, n=45). Demographic characteristics were not significantly different between the groups. When compared with the control group, the gestational age at delivery was significantly higher (33.11±3.16 vs 30.22±4.12 weeks; P=.001) and the pregnancy latency was significantly longer (72.40±22.51 vs 45.56±28.82 days; P<.001) in the ultrasound-indicated cerclage group. The rates of spontaneous preterm birth at <28, <32, <34, and <36 weeks' gestation were significantly lower in the ultrasound-indicated cerclage group than in the control group. In terms of neonatal outcomes, there were significant reductions in the overall perinatal mortality (4.4% vs 20.0%; P<.001), neonatal intensive care unit admissions (69.0% vs 92.6%; P<.001), and composite adverse neonatal outcomes (43.7% vs 64.7%; P=.010) for the ultrasound-indicated cerclage group when compared with the control group. In the subgroup of women with a transvaginal cervical length of between 15 and 24 mm (with 21 in the ultrasound-indicated cerclage group vs 21 controls), the data were adjusted for maternal age, pregestational body mass index, in vitro fertilization, operative hysteroscopy, previous cervical surgery, previous spontaneous preterm birth, white blood cell counts, C-reactive protein level, neutrophil to lymphocyte ratio, and the shortest transvaginal cervical length measured at diagnosis. In ultrasound-indicated cerclage group, gestational age at delivery was significantly higher (32.95±3.81 vs 30.24±4.01 weeks; beta, 3.34; 95% confidence interval, 0.14-6.55; P=.042), pregnancy latency was significantly prolonged (77.19±24.81 vs 48.52±29.67 days; beta, 33.81; 95% confidence interval, 12.29-55.34; P=.003), and the rates of spontaneous preterm birth <36 weeks' gestation (57.1% vs 95.2%; adjusted odds ratio, 0.03; 95% confidence interval, 0.01-0.69; P=.029) was significantly decreased, and for neonatal outcomes, there were significant reductions in neonatal intensive care unit admissions (53.7% vs 96.7%; adjusted odds ratio, 0.04; 95% confidence interval, 0.01-0.32; P=.003) and the composite adverse neonatal outcomes (39.0% vs 73.3%; adjusted odds ratio, 0.24; 95% confidence interval, 0.08-0.68; P=.008) in the ultrasound-indicated cerclage group when compared with the control group. In the subgroup of women with a transvaginal cervical length <15 mm, gestational age at delivery was higher (33.25±2.52 vs 30.00±4.33 weeks; beta, 3.96; 95% confidence interval, 1.51-6.42; P=.002), pregnancy latency was significantly prolonged (68.21±19.85 vs 42.96±28.43 days; beta, 30.11; 95% confidence interval, 12.42-47.81; P=.001), rates of spontaneous preterm birth at <32 weeks (16.7% vs 54.2%; adjusted odds ratio, 0.10; 95% confidence interval, 0.01-0.61; P=.020) and <34 weeks (54.2% vs 83.3%, adjusted odds ratio, 0.08; 95% confidence interval, 0.01-0.66; P=.019) of gestation was significantly decreased, and neonatal birthweight was significantly increased (2023.96±510.35 vs 1421.77±611.40 g; beta, 702.40; 95% confidence interval, 297.02-1107.78; P=.001) in the ultrasound-indicated cerclage group when compared with the control group. CONCLUSION: Cerclage among women with twin pregnancies with a transvaginal cervical length <25 mm may reduce the rate of spontaneous preterm birth and improve perinatal and neonatal outcomes when compared with expectant management. It is worth noting that even with a short transvaginal cervical length of 15 to 24 mm, cerclage will significantly decrease the risk of delivery at <36 weeks' gestation and prolong pregnancy latency. Among women with a short transvaginal cervical length <15 mm, cerclage will significantly decrease the risk of delivery at <32 and <34 weeks' gestation and prolong pregnancy latency.

Background: Antenatally diagnosed sacrococcygeal teratoma has been associated with risks of perinatal complications and death, especially when the foetus has symptoms of cardiac insufficiency, hydrops or anemia in utero; however, the method of intervention remains controversial. Case: A 25-year-old pregnant woman was found to have a cystic and solid tumor in the fetal sacrococcygeal region at 16 weeks of gestation. As the tumour grew, the mother developed polyhydramnios accompanied with gestational diabetes. Fetal and tumorous hemodynamics were closely monitored by ultrasound. Abnormal cardiac function was detected at 31 weeks' gestation, and we creatively performed pre-emptive delivery through the ex-utero intrapartum treatment with debulking. The teratoma was removed with utero-placental circulation support. The operation proceeded smoothly with favourable prognosis for both mother and newborn. Conclusion: The ex-utero intrapartum treatment may improve the prognosis for fetuses with heart failure when they reach viable gestation.

Influenza A(H3N2) virus exhibited complex seasonal patterns to evade pre-existing antibodies, resulting in changes in the antigenicity of the viron surface protein hemagglutinin (HA). To monitor the currently imported influenza viruses as well as to assess the capacity of health emergencies at the Shanghai port, we collected respiratory specimens of passengers from different countries and regions including some of Europe with influenza-like illness at the Shanghai port during 2016/2017, examined amino acid substitutions, and calculated the perfect-match vaccine efficacy using the p epitope model. Phylogenetic analysis of the HA genes revealed that influenza A(H3N2) viruses belonging to eight subclades were detected, and three amino acid substitutions in the subclade 3C.2a.4 were also added. Besides, two epidemic influenza virus strains were found in the 2016/2017 winter and 2016 summer. The results of lower predicted vaccine effectiveness in summer suggest that the imported A(H3N2) strains were not a good match for the A/Hong Kong/4801/2014 vaccine strain since the summer of 2017. Therefore, the Shanghai Port might stop the risk of the international spread of influenza for the first time, and curb the entry of A(H3N2) from overseas at the earliest stage of a probable influenza pandemic.

Objective: To develop a nomogram to predict preterm birth before 28 weeks in pregnant women undergoing cervical cerclage. Study design: We retrospectively studied the medical records on pregnant women who underwent cervical cerclage in January 2016 to September 2020. We developed the model from a development cohort in Women's Hospital, Zhejiang university, School of medicine, which randomly divided by 7:3 into training cohort for nomogram development, and internal validation cohort to confirm the model's performance. We then tested the nomogram in an external validation cohort over a similar period. The Harrell's C-index, calibration curve, decision curve analyses (DCA) were performed to assess the model. Results: 528 patients formed the development cohort, and 97 patients formed the external validation cohort. The model initially incorporated 10 baseline variables, while 5 variables were estimated in the nomogram at last: history of prior second-trimester loss, use of in-vitro fertilization (IVF), cervical dilation at cerclage, C-reactive protein (CRP) and platelet-lymphocyte ratio (PLR). The nomogram achieved good concordance indexes of 0.82(95%CI 0.77-0.88), 0.80(95%CI 0.72-0.88) and 0.79 (95%CI 0.68-0.90) in the training, internal and external validation cohort, respectively. And the nomogram had well-fitted calibration curves. Decision curve analysis demonstrated that the nomogram was clinically useful. Conclusions: The well-performed nomogram graphically represents the risk factors and a pre-operative predicted model in predicting the risk of preterm birth at <28 weeks in singleton pregnant women undergoing cervical cerclage. The model can provide a useful guide for clinicians and patients in making appropriate clinical decisions.

Heat shock transcription factor (Hsf) exists widely in eukaryotes and responds to various abiotic stresses by regulating the expression of downstream transcription factors, functional enzymes, and molecular chaperones. In this study, TaHsfA2-13, a heat shock transcription factor belonging to A2 subclass, was cloned from wheat (Triticum aestivum) and its function was analyzed. TaHsfA2-13 encodes a protein containing 368 amino acids and has the basic characteristics of Hsfs. Multiple sequence alignment analysis showed that TaHsfA2-13 protein had the highest similarity with TdHsfA2c-like protein from Triticum dicoccoides, which reached 100%. The analysis of tissue expression characteristics revealed that TaHsfA2-13 was highly expressed in root, shoot, and leaf during the seedling stage of wheat. The expression of TaHsfA2-13 could be upregulated by heat stress, low temperature, H2O2, mannitol, salinity and multiple phytohormones. The TaHsfA2-13 protein was located in the nucleus under the normal growth conditions and showed a transcriptional activation activity in yeast. Further studies found that overexpression of TaHsfA2-13 in Arabidopsis thaliana Col-0 or athsfa2 mutant results in improved tolerance to heat stress, H2O2, SA and mannitol by regulating the expression of multiple heat shock protein (Hsp) genes. In summary, our study identified TaHsfA2-13 from wheat, revealed its regulatory function in varieties of abiotic stresses, and will provide a new target gene to improve stress tolerance for wheat breeding.

Objective: The offspring of women with gestational diabetes mellitus (GDM) have a high predisposition to developing type 2 diabetes during childhood and adulthood. The aim of the study was to evaluate how GDM exposure in the second half of pregnancy contributes to hepatic glucose intolerance through a mouse model. Methods: By creating a GDM mouse model, we tested glucose and insulin tolerance of offspring by intraperitoneal glucose tolerance test (IPGTT), insulin tolerance test (ITT), and pyruvate tolerance test (PTT). In addition, we checked the expression of genes IGF2/H19, FoxO1, and DNMTs in the mouse liver by RT-qPCR. Pyrosequencing was used to detect the methylation status on IGF2/H19 differentially methylated regions (DMRs). In vitro insulin stimulation experiments were performed to evaluate the effect of different insulin concentrations on HepG2 cells. Moreover, we detect the interaction between FoxO1 and DNMT3A by chromatin immunoprecipitation-quantitative PCR (Chip-qPCR) and knock-down experiments on HepG2 cells. Results: We found that the first generation of GDM offspring (GDM-F1) exhibited impaired glucose tolerance (IGT) and insulin resistance, with males being disproportionately affected. In addition, the expression of imprinted genes IGF2 and H19 was downregulated in the livers of male mice via hypermethylation of IGF2-DMR0 and IGF2-DMR1. Furthermore, increased expression of transcriptional factor FoxO1 was confirmed to regulate DNMT3A expression, which contributed to abnormal methylation of IGF2/H19 DMRs. Notably, different insulin treatments on HepG2 demonstrated those genetic alterations, suggesting that they might be induced by intrauterine hyperinsulinemia. Conclusion: Our results demonstrated that the intrauterine hyperinsulinemia environment has increased hepatic FoxO1 levels and subsequently increased expression of DNMT3A and epigenetic alterations on IGF2/H19 DMRs. These findings provide potential molecular mechanisms responsible for glucose intolerance and insulin resistance in the first male generation of GDM mice.

Cervical insufficiency is a major cause of second-trimester pregnancy loss and spontaneous preterm delivery. Transabdominal cervicoisthmic cerclage is usually performed before pregnancy for patients of cervical insufficiency, in whom transvaginal cervical cerclage procedure cannot be placed or has failed previously. Performing a transabdominal cerclage becomes a huge challenge owing to the enlargement of the pregnant uterus in patients who were indicated for transabdominal cervicoisthmic cerclage but were missed before pregnancy. Here, we have outlined an easy and effective surgical procedure as needle-free laparoscopic trans-broad-ligament cervicoisthmic cerclage during early second-trimester. Laparoscope with 4 trocars was established, after expanding the trigonum of ureter, ovarian vascular and ascending branch of uterine artery. The needleless Mersilene tape was inserted in a posterior-to-anterior direction of bilateral trigonums, tightening the knot toward the bladder uterine reflection and simultaneously pushing the loop behind the uterus, directed to the cervix progressively. The tape was then tied anteriorly at the cervico-isthmic junction with 5 to 6 intracorporeal square knots after transvaginal ultrasound determined the presence of systolic velocity of uterine artery with first knot. The primary feature of our procedure was that the needleless Mersilene tape was inserted centrally from the broad ligaments, lateral to the uterine vessels, and finally tied above the uterosacral ligament at the level of the uterine isthmus, without dissecting the bladder off from lower uterine segment and without separating the uterine vessels from the lateral wall of the cervix. We performed this procedure on 10 patients with pregnancy outcomes and there was no pregnancy loss. This procedure proved to be an accessible and effective surgical technique for transabdominal cerclage of the uterine cervix during early-second trimester, with affirmative prognosis.

BACKGROUND: Cephalopelvic disproportion (CPD)-related obstructed labor is associated with maternal and neonatal morbidity and mortality. Accurate prediction of whether a primiparous woman is at high risk of an unplanned cesarean delivery would be a major advance in obstetrics. PURPOSE: To develop and validate a predictive model assessing the risk of cesarean delivery in primiparous women based on MRI findings. STUDY TYPE: Prospective. POPULATION: A total of 150 primiparous women with clinical findings suggestive of CPD. FIELD STRENGTH/SEQUENCE: T1-weighted fast spin-echo sequences, single-shot fast spin-echo (SSFSE) T2-weighted sequences at 1.5 T. ASSESSMENT: Pelvimetry and fetal biometry were assessed independently by two radiologists. A nomogram model combined that the clinical and MRI characteristics was constructed. STATISTICAL TESTS: Univariable and multivariable logistic regression analyses were applied to select independent variables. Receiver operating characteristic (ROC) analysis was performed, and the discrimination of the model was assessed by the area under the curve (AUC). Calibration was assessed by calibration plots. Decision curve analysis was applied to evaluate the net clinical benefit. A P value below 0.05 was considered to be statistically significant. RESULTS: In multivariable modeling, the maternal body mass index (BMI) before delivery, bilateral femoral head distance, obstetric conjugate, fetal head circumference, and fetal abdominal circumference was significantly associated with the likelihood of cesarean delivery. The discrimination calculated as the AUC was 0.838 (95% confidence interval [CI]: 0.774-0.902). The sensitivity and specificity of the nomogram model were 0.787 and 0.764, and the positive predictive and negative predictive values were 0.696 and 0.840, respectively. The model demonstrated satisfactory calibration (calibration slope = 0.945). Moreover, the decision curve analysis proved the superior net benefit of the model compared with each factor included. DATA CONCLUSION: Our study might provide a nomogram model that could identify primiparous women at risk of cesarean delivery caused by CPD based on MRI measurements. EVIDENCE LEVEL: 2 TECHNICAL EFFICACY: Stage 2.

The aim of our study was to compare the efficacy of two dosages of hepatitis B immunoglobulin (HBIG) combined with HBV vaccine (HBVac) to prevent mother-to-child transmission (MTCT) of hepatitis B in HBsAg- and HBeAg-positive mother. We enrolled 331 mother-infant pairs with HBsAg- and HBeAg-positive maternal state from the Women's Hospital School of Medicine of Zhejiang University. Newborns were randomly distributed into two groups according to the dosages of HBIG injection: 100 IU and 200 IU. Newborns from both groups were injected with HBVac in the same doses. We compared the immune outcomes between the two groups and explore the influencing factors of immune outcomes through regression analysis. There was no statistically significant relationship between HBsAg serological transmission of newborns and dosages of HBIG in HBsAg- and HBeAg-positive mother (p > .05). The Logistic regression showed that high DNA load is a risk factor for passive-active immunoprophylaxis failure for both 100 IU and 200 IU group, but higher-dosage HBIG is not necessary for higher-viral-load pregnant women with HBsAg- and HBeAg-positive. In conclusion, combined application of HBVac and a single dose of 100 IU HBIG can achieve the ideal MTCT interruption results for HBsAg- and HBeAg-positive pregnant women.IMPACT STATEMENTWhat is already known on this subject? Passive-active immunoprophylaxis is proved to be effective in preventing mother-to-child transmission of hepatitis B. Hepatitis B vaccine combined with 100 IU or 200 IU immunoglobulin is mostly recommended in China.What do the results of this study add? At present, there is still a lack scientific basis for improving existing strategies and measures to prevent mother-to-child transmission of hepatitis B in China.What are the implications of these findings for clinical practice and/or further research? 100 IU and 200 IU immunoglobulin show equivalent blocking effect, and combined use of hepatitis B vaccine and 100 IU immunoglobulin is more cost-effective.
